16 Percent of Voters Turn Out by Noon in Greenwich

GREENWICH, Conn. – A total 16 percent, or 5,287 of 33,893, registered Greenwich voters cast their ballots Tuesday by noon, the registrar of voters reported.

Here is the breakdown of polling districts in Greenwich:

•District 1 (South Center): 422 of 2,634 registered voters or about 16 percent

•District 2 (Harbor): 334 of 2,128 registered voters or about 16 percent

•District 3 (Chickahominy): 152 of 1,389 registered voters or about 11 percent

•District 4 (Byram): 343 of 2,415 registered voters or about 14 percent

•District 5 (Riverside): 573 of 2,767 registered voters or about 21 percent

•District 6 (Old Greenwich): 572 of 2,873 registered voters or about 20 percent

•District 7 (North Center): 396 of 2,942 registered voters or about 13 percent

•District 8 (Cos Cob): 671 of 3,859 registered voters or about 17 percent

•District 9 (Pemberwick-Glenville): 453 of 2,945 registered voters or about 15 percent

•District 10 (Northwest): 371 of 3,143 registered voters or about 12 percent

•District 11 (Northeast): 448 of 3,597 registered voters or about 12 percent

•District 12 (Havemeyer): 552 of 3,201 registered voters or about 17 percent
